Couple of quick things regarding spam calls:

1. I set my iPhone to ring only if the caller is in my Contacts list. That makes a huge difference since unknown numbers no longer ring. 98% of spammers do not leave messages.

2. If you really want to get nasty, here is a trick. Get a whistle-- a loud one like sporting events. Answer the spam call, act interested but slowly start talking more and more softly getting down to almost a whisper. On the other end, the $#@^#W^ spammer is dialing up the volume on their headset. Then blow the whistle and hang up.

That bigger grader is almost too big for most driveways. The little Galion would do a much better job. it just wont cut as deep for the potholes. No weight, not like the big one.
Back when I plowed snow for the City of Toronto, I preferred a grader, until one night they put me on a sidewalk plow. Then the fun began. 450 John Deere dozer (6 way blade) with worn out grousers. Side curtains down the sides to keep your legs warm and big heavy winter coveralls, balaclava and a brain bucket with winter gloves and plow away. Always after midnight.
